Transaction 66074167b78821b427592fa873d9e960eab3ece51fda3b20a0e4bac2b04cccda
1 Input
1 Output
-
66074167b78821b427592fa873d9e960eab3ece51fda3b20a0e4bac2b04cccda:0
- value
- 300986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b1a8f06ab0cba7342727f53324eff3d4c490ae9 OP_EQUAL
- address
- 3Fq8UcDWQtpFAJMbSigxazES9DwcHwhv8i